What is the equation of a line that goes through the point (0,-3) and m=1/4

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 02-04-2020

Answer:

y = 1/4x - 3

Step-by-step explanation:

The point (0, -3) is the y-intercept of the linear graph, therefore b in this equation will be -3. The slope provided in the question is 1/4, so you plug them into the equation.

y = 1/4x - 3
